Traditionally, the tassa is created by tightly covering a clay shell with goat skin, utilizing an intricate, archaic system. The hides of monkey, deer, and horse are periodically employed. When ready to play, the goat pores and skin is heated by help of a fireplace to tighten the head, producing the pitch bigger. This process is termed "standing it up". In this manner, the pitch can continue to be superior for twenty–half-hour, until finally the warmth dissipates from both of those the skin and the inside of the drum.

In Assam, the dhol is broadly Employed in Rongali Bihu (Bohag Bihu), the Assamese new yr celebrations during the month of April. Celebrated in mid-April each year (ordinarily on 14 or 13 April in accordance with the Assamese traditional calendar), the dhol is an important and a quintessential instrument Utilized in Bihu dance. The origin of your Dhol in Assam dates back again to at least the 14th century when it had been referred in Assamese Buranjis as remaining performed through the indigenous persons. This shows that the origin of Dhol in Assam was Considerably more mature than the remainder of India, as well as the title was probably as a result of sanskritisation.

In Maharashtra, dhol is usually a Principal instrument Utilized in Ganesh festivals. In town of Pune, locals arrive together to kind dhol pathaks (troupes). Pune supposedly has the most important number of dhols in India. In town of Nagpur, there are plenty of troupes that Enjoy dhol on festivals and also other instances. Right here dhol here is often called 'Sandhal'. Dhol is made up of two stretched membranes tied by a powerful string.

A single side with the dhol is performed by wooden adhere named "tiparu", on that side black coloured ink paste adhere from the centre. This membrane is called the "dhum". In technical language, it known as base. An additional facet of dhol is known as "thapi" or "chati". In technological language, it is referred to as as tremer, this aspect of membrane is barely played by palm. Boll of the dhol is "Taa", "Dhin" and "Dha". "Taa" for your "Thapi" facet, "Dhin" for your "Dhum" facet and "Dha" for each side performed collectively.
